The 911 is about 7 lbs per hp, so it takes about 10 of the X51's extra 30 hp just to compensate for the 75 lbs heavier PDK. Add a bunch more options weight, easily half or more of the GTS's extra power could be eaten up just compensating for all that. As I recall, most of the extra 30 comes just before redline. Most driving though is midrange, where the differences are slight. At some points on the power curve the S is dead even on torque, and that's what counts more than hp anyway. So its not surprising the GTS didn't feel any faster than your S. Depending on options weight and how you were driving it may well have been slower!
